SSM+Vue搬家预约系统开发教程
需积分: 0 115 浏览量
更新于2024-12-02
收藏 49.77MB ZIP 举报
资源摘要信息:"基于ssm+vue的搬家预约系统" 是一个IT项目的名称,该项目采用了Java语言的Spring框架以及Vue前端框架进行开发。"ssm" 是指Spring、SpringMVC、MyBatis三种框架的简称,它们在Java开发中被广泛应用于构建企业级的应用程序。Spring是一个轻量级的控制反转(IoC)和面向切面(AOP)的容器框架,SpringMVC是一个实现了Web框架功能的MVC框架,而MyBatis则是一个支持定制化SQL、存储过程以及高级映射的持久层框架。
项目后端采用的ssm框架,通过这种整合方式能够简化开发流程,提高开发效率,同时利用Spring的依赖注入功能,可以降低组件之间的耦合度,使得项目更加容易维护。SpringMVC处理Web层的请求,进行模型(Model)、视图(View)和控制器(Controller)的分层,使得代码结构更加清晰。MyBatis则在数据访问层提供了一个半自动化的ORM(对象关系映射)实现,使得开发者可以集中精力处理业务逻辑,而不用花费大量时间编写底层SQL语句。
前端使用Vue框架,Vue是一个构建用户界面的渐进式JavaScript框架,专注于视图层。Vue的核心库只关注视图层,易于上手,也便于与第三方库或现有项目整合。此外Vue还支持组件化开发,使得前端代码模块化更加高效,维护起来也更加方便。
这个项目还涉及到微信小程序的开发,微信小程序是一种不需要下载安装即可使用的应用,它实现了应用“触手可及”的梦想,用户扫一扫或搜一下即可打开应用。微信小程序主要使用了微信官方提供的开发框架和开发工具,这使得开发者可以利用微信强大的功能和庞大的用户群体,为用户提供便捷的服务。
标签中提到的"毕业设计"可能意味着这个项目是作为学生学习的最后阶段所完成的项目,用于展示学生在学习过程中的能力,包括技术掌握程度、项目实施能力等。通常,毕业设计项目会要求学生独立完成从项目选题、需求分析、设计实现到项目测试的整个软件开发生命周期。
综上所述,这个项目是一个结合了后端ssm框架和前端Vue技术的完整系统,旨在提供一个便捷的搬家预约服务。它不仅能够满足用户随时随地通过微信小程序预约搬家的需求,还能够通过前后端分离的方式,提高系统的可维护性和扩展性。此项目对于学习Java后端开发、前端Vue框架以及小程序开发的学生或开发者来说,是一个很好的学习材料和实践案例。
2024-10-08 上传
点击了解资源详情
点击了解资源详情
2024-08-25 上传
2024-09-28 上传
2024-06-30 上传
2024-07-31 上传
2024-09-11 上传
伟大先锋
- 粉丝: 120
- 资源: 1689
最新资源
- Angular程序高效加载与展示海量Excel数据技巧
- Argos客户端开发流程及Vue配置指南
- 基于源码的PHP Webshell审查工具介绍
- Mina任务部署Rpush教程与实践指南
- 密歇根大学主题新标签页壁纸与多功能扩展
- Golang编程入门:基础代码学习教程
- Aplysia吸引子分析MATLAB代码套件解读
- 程序性竞争问题解决实践指南
- lyra: Rust语言实现的特征提取POC功能
- Chrome扩展:NBA全明星新标签壁纸
- 探索通用Lisp用户空间文件系统clufs_0.7
- dheap: Haxe实现的高效D-ary堆算法
- 利用BladeRF实现简易VNA频率响应分析工具
- 深度解析Amazon SQS在C#中的应用实践
- 正义联盟计划管理系统:udemy-heroes-demo-09
- JavaScript语法jsonpointer替代实现介绍